Welcome to the fourth episode of Magazine St. Kitchen x Swiggy presents Speak Greasy with Gauri Devidayal Season 4. This episode brings together two powerhouse women in India’s bartending scene: Aashi Bhatnagar and Shatbhi Basu.

Aashi Bhatnagar, also known as Pocket Dynamyte, is an award-winning mixologist from Pune, known for her innovative approach to cocktail-making and for representing India at the prestigious World Class by Diageo competition. Shatbhi Basu is a legend in the Indian bar industry, celebrated as the country’s first female bartender, the founder of STIR Academy of Bartending, and the author of India’s first comprehensive beverage books.

In this conversation, Gauri delves into the unexpected career paths of both guests. Shatbhi originally wanted to be a Chinese chef before finding herself behind the bar, where she discovered a passion for mixology and the hospitality industry. Her journey took her from working extra shifts in Bombay bars to launching STIR Academy, designing bars, curating cocktail menus, and becoming a leading voice in India’s beverage space. Aashi, on the other hand, initially aspired to be a fashion designer, but a twist of fate led her to bartending, where she now designs cocktails instead of dresses.

The discussion explores the challenges and triumphs of women in the male-dominated bartending world. Shatbhi shares her experience of being one of only 12 women in a class of 100, while Aashi recounts how she was one of just two female students in her class of 40. Both speak about pushing boundaries, proving their skills, and earning respect in a field that often underestimated them.

The episode also touches on the evolution of the Indian cocktail scene, with insights into how global trends are influencing local bars. Shatbhi, who has been educating consumers and industry professionals for decades, discusses the importance of understanding spirits, flavour profiles, and the art of cocktail-making. Aashi shares how she infuses culinary elements into her cocktails, creating unique drinks that blend tradition with modern techniques.

From the early days of faxing drink recipes to newspapers to winning international bartending competitions, this conversation highlights the persistence, creativity, and passion that have driven both women to the top of their industry.
